sunnnyduan 2020-05-31
因为easy-mock 仅支持node8.x版本 所以需要同时存在低版本node
用于管理多个node
版本的工具。
安装:
nvm-setup.zip
安装版,下载之后解压安装即可;# 更换淘宝源 nvm node_mirror https://npm.taobao.org/mirrors/node/ # 开启nvm nvm on
常用命令:
命令 | 含义 |
---|---|
nvm | 查看所有命令 |
nvm on | 开启nvm |
nvm list | 查看现在使用的node版本 |
nvm node_mirror node镜像地址 | 设置node镜像地址 |
nvm npm_mirror npm镜像地址 | 设置npm镜像地址 |
nvm install node版本号 | 安装指定版本node |
nvm use node版本号 | 使用指定版本node |
nvm uninsstall node版本号 | 卸载指定版本node |
官网下载安装包安装之后一直下一步,我这里是安装到D:\MongoDB
目录下,根据自己情况自行更改;
主要有下面几步:
D:\MongoDB\data
下面新建一个文件夹db
? D:\MongoDB\log
下面新建一个文件mongo.log
创建服务 把可执行文件的D:\MongoDB\bin
添加到系统变量里;
管理员权限的cmd中注册服务:mongod --config "D:\MongoDB\mongo.conf" --install --serviceName "MongoDB"
? cmd中开启服务:net start mongodb
? 这时候浏览器中访问127.0.0.1:27017
应该就已经有内容了
? 如果之前安装无误的话,cmd中输入mongo
应该就可以进入mongo的可执行环境了,这时输入db
应显示test
mongo`运行环境下:`use easymockdb
Redis类似,在Github-release下载一个msi版本安装,一直下一步;
添加路径
添加安装路径D:\Redis
到系统变量里
创建服务
cmd下redis-server redis.windows.conf
安装为windows服务
? 安装为windows服务后 可以关闭命令行依然启动服务
? cmd中注册服务:redis-server --service-install redis.windows-service.conf --loglevel verbose
? 注册后需要开启服务 redis-server --service-start
常用Redis命令:
redis-server --service-uninstall
redis-server --service-start
redis-server --service-stop
具体安装从git上clone下来并install
、build
git clone https://github.com/easy-mock/easy-mock.git cd easy-mock npm install npm run build npm run start
这时候访问本地的 http://localhost:7300
就可以打开Easy-Mock页面了,跟Easy-Mock官网一样的~
没有配置文件可以在 .nvm 中复制粘贴一个隐藏文件修改名字,将内容修改为如下代码:。[ -s "$NVM_DIR/nvm.sh" ] && \. "$NVM_DIR/nvm.sh" # This l